Lafayette Fire Department has practice house burn

The Lafayette Fire Department had the opportunity to practice last Thursday as they burnt down Daune and Melva Eckberg’s former home. Seven generations of Eckberg memories was the way one of the great-granddaughters summarized the house. The house was built in 1907 by Carl “Charlie” Eckberg and his wife Emma. Then son Kenneth and Annie Lou Eckberg moved in. In 1962 grandson Duane and Melva Eckberg took over the home with their three daughters. Duane and Melva moved into Winthrop seven years ago.
